Does Soi 38 Have a Michelin Star?

Soi 38 is one of Bangkok’s most beloved street-food havens, with a wide array of traditional Thai snacks and dishes available. Its menu is vast and varied, from pad thai to som tam to boat noodles. But the question remains; does Soi 38 have a Michelin star?

The answer is no, unfortunately. Soi 38 has not received a Michelin star, nor has it been included in the Michelin Guide.

However, this doesn’t mean that it isn’t worth visiting. Quite the contrary – Soi 38 offers a wide range of authentic Thai street food that can’t be found anywhere else in the world.
